Position Summary

In compliance with Board policies and procedures, responsible for supporting the Health and Safety Manager in planning, developing and maintaining comprehensive environmental (e.g., asbestos, well water, indoor air quality) and fire safety programs by providing advice and participating through the evaluation, development, implementation and monitoring of programs, policies, procedures and guidelines in compliance with the Environmental Protection Act, Occupational Health and Safety Act, and Ontario Fire Code and related Regulations.

Major

Responsibilities
  • To meet, consult and liaise with internal and external working groups on environmental health & safety requirements and act as a resource for school Administrators, department managers, employees and health and safety committees.
  • To evaluate and monitor school/site/Board compliance with the Ontario Fire Code, Drinking Water Regulation, confined space, and Designated Substance – Asbestos on Construction Projects and in Buildings and Repair Operations Regulation.
  • To investigate, test, monitor, and report on building environment and working conditions including air quality, sound levels, and temperature and make recommendations and provide advice to management and appropriate staff.
  • To monitor and maintain assessments including asbestos management, water sampling, hearing conservation, hazardous waste storage and disposal, and well water management. This includes coordinating surveys, sampling and monitoring the status of removal or repair work.
  • To develop, coordinate and deliver training on environmental health and safety issues, such as Asbestos, Fire Code Compliance and Well Water Management, including the maintenance of related materials.
  • To support Disability Management on employee accommodation and claims such as scent sensitivities, chemical/environmental sensitivities, concussion management, and hearing loss claims.
  • To liaise with outside government agencies and their agents, such as York Region Health Services, Ministry of Labour, and Ministry of the Environment, as required.
  • To implement and maintain the Hearing Conservation Program, including researching, providing, and tracking hearing protection for teaching staff and validating Hearing Loss claims with WSIB.
  • To research and monitor pertinent legislation, codes for updates, changes, or new developments in environmental health & safety.
  • To provide support and response to queries, emergency situations, and/or complaints from Board staff or Public Health regarding working environment and conditions and coordinating with third party consultants if necessary.
  • To develop, write and distribute health & safety correspondence as required.
  • To attend, advise and provide consultation to all Board MJOSHCs on matters arising during the meetings and the mandated requirements of committee as indicated by legislation.
  • To perform other duties as assigned.

Education, Experience And Qualifications
  • A three-year university degree or college diploma in health and safety, environmental studies, fire prevention or a related discipline is required.
  • Minimum five to seven years in dealing with environmental safety issues related to asbestos, drinking water, indoor air quality and fire prevention or related experience is required.
  • Preferred certification and/or training in relevant health and safety topics including industrial hygiene, ergonomics, risk assessment, project management, HVAC and building envelope, and environmental and water treatment and technologies.
  • Preferred certification in Small Drinking Water systems Operator.
  • Must possess a valid Ontario Driver’s License and have access to own transportation.
